Are You Tired Of Living With An Incomplete Smile?

Until you do something about tooth loss, you can find yourself frustrated by the cosmetic and oral health impact of having an incomplete smile. The effect on your appearance can vary. For some, a missing tooth is easy to hide, while others may have difficulty keeping a gap out of view. Even if your problem is difficult to observe, it can be difficult to adjust to biting and chewing while working around an empty space. You should also be aware that tooth loss is capable of causing more losses, as neighboring teeth have less natural support.

Making Plans To Replace Lost Teeth

Restorative dental work that gives you back your full smile can have a significant effect on your appearance and oral health. For patients with missing teeth, we can discuss the benefits of undergoing treatment that includes the placement and restoration of a dental implant, or of several implants. This work will enable us to permanently secure a crown or larger restoration to your jawbone. The stability provided by your implant allows you to bite and chew food in a way that feels comfortable to you. You can even protect your jawbone by stimulating the tissues when you use your restoration.
